In a four-part special event series, 14 ordinary Aussies will go to hell and back in the hope of passing SAS Australia: Hell Week.

A stay-at-home mum, a fashion designer and a rapper are just some of the people who will take on the physically and mentally taxing Special Forces course beginning Monday, October 18.
These normies will be pushed beyond their limits, with no allowances made for their age or gender. In the Directing Staff’s eyes, you either have what it takes, or you don’t.
“It’s going to take a very special individual to get to this end of this course,” said Chief Instructor Ant Middleton. “Pain will be constant and we will weed out the weak.
“They’re going to realise very quickly why it’s called Hell Week.”
